>> There's a new experimental feature for the admin app in trunk. When you 
>> visit an app's design page, the plugin download button at the bottom links 
>> to a page with a list of available contributed plugin packages that will be 
>> automagically downloaded and installed for you.
>>
>> The list of available plugins is provided by the web2pyslices.comarticle 
>> search api. Warning: The current list is very small and some of the 
>> links will not work since the plugin package slice is required to post a 
>> direct .w2p archive dowload url.
>>
>> Note to web2pyslices users: Please update your plugin posts so they 
>> specify a link to a .w2p file at the download field. Note also that if you 
>> are using Google code as project hosting, they have dropped support for 
>> archive downloads.
